About IGNOU MGGE-004 – HYDROLOGY AND WATER RESOURCES

Hydrology and water resource management represent a critical branch of environmental geosciences focusing on the distribution, movement, and quality of water across the Earth. This course is designed for post-graduate students specializing in geoinformatics or environmental science who need to understand the physical processes of the hydrological cycle and the technical methods used for sustainable water management. It bridges the gap between theoretical atmospheric science and practical engineering solutions for water scarcity and flood control.

What MGGE-004 Covers — Key Themes for the Exam

Analyzing the thematic structure of the Term End Examination (TEE) is essential for any student aiming to master this complex subject. Since the syllabus blends physical geography with mathematical modeling and resource planning, identifying recurring patterns in the question papers allows for a more strategic study plan. These themes reflect the core competencies expected of a professional in the field of hydrology, focusing on both natural processes and human interventions in the water cycle.

  • The Global Hydrological Cycle — Examiners frequently test the quantitative assessment of the water balance equation and the interconnectedness of evaporation, condensation, and precipitation. Understanding these fundamental mechanics is vital because they form the baseline for all advanced hydrological modeling and climate change impact assessments.
  • Surface Water and Runoff Dynamics — A significant portion of the exam focuses on hydrograph analysis, streamflow measurement, and the factors influencing watershed runoff. This theme is crucial as it directly relates to practical applications like flood forecasting, dam design, and the management of river basins in diverse topographical regions.
  • Groundwater Occurrence and Movement — Questions often delve into the properties of aquifers, Darcy’s Law, and the mechanics of well hydraulics. Mastery of this theme is necessary for addressing real-world challenges such as groundwater depletion, saltwater intrusion in coastal areas, and the sustainable exploitation of subsurface water reserves.
  • Water Quality and Hydro-geochemistry — This theme covers the physical, chemical, and biological characteristics of water and the standards required for different uses. Students are tested on their ability to interpret water quality data, which is fundamental for ensuring public health and protecting aquatic ecosystems from industrial and agricultural pollution.
  • Water Resources Planning and Management — Examiners look for an understanding of Integrated Water Resources Management (IWRM) and the legal frameworks governing water usage. This involves evaluating the socio-economic aspects of water distribution and the strategies for rainwater harvesting and watershed development in arid environments.
  • Applied Hydrology and Remote Sensing — Recurring questions explore how modern technologies like GIS and Satellite Imagery are used to map water bodies and monitor snowmelt. This highlights the importance of technological integration in contemporary hydrological research and the precision it brings to resource mapping.

How Past Papers Help You Score Better in TEE

Exam Pattern

The TEE for this course typically consists of a 100-mark paper to be solved in 3 hours. It usually includes a mix of long-form essay questions (20 marks) and short descriptive notes (5-10 marks), testing both breadth and depth.

Important Topics

Hydrograph analysis, Darcy’s Law for groundwater flow, and the principles of Watershed Management are high-frequency topics that appear in almost every session’s question set for this course.

Answer Writing

For Hydrology, always supplement your text with neatly labeled diagrams (like the hydrological cycle or cross-sections of aquifers). Use bullet points for management strategies and highlight specific formulas used in calculations.

Time Management

Allocate roughly 35 minutes for each 20-mark question. Reserve the last 15 minutes of the 3-hour session for reviewing calculations and ensuring all units (like cubic meters per second) are correctly labeled in your answers.

FAQs – IGNOU MGGE-004 Previous Year Question Papers

Are numerical problems common in the past papers of this course?
Yes, numerical problems related to the water balance equation, infiltration rates, and aquifer discharge are frequently included. Practicing these from these papers is essential for scoring high marks in the technical sections.
Does IGNOU repeat questions in the MGGE-004 TEE?
While exact questions may not always repeat, the core themes such as Rainwater Harvesting and Hydrograph Analysis are consistently featured. Reviewing the past papers helps identify these recurring concepts.
How many years of question papers should I solve for Hydrology?
It is recommended to solve at least the last 5 years of exam papers to understand the evolving nature of water resource management policies and technical standards used by IGNOU examiners.
Can I find the solutions for these question papers on the IGNOU portal?
No, the official portal only provides the questions. For solutions, you should refer to your MGGE-004 study blocks or use the solved assignment booklets as a reference for the correct answer format.
What is the best way to use these papers for final revision?
The best approach is to solve the TEE papers under timed conditions. This builds the stamina required for the 3-hour exam and helps you perfect your diagram-drawing speed for hydrological cycles.
